Output 12bbcfc27ecee34ea69a299ef0d6243b14afcdbadf745590911460240e589b64:0

value
808480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b128636255be3c12f17810af76d78ba2760ecd1a OP_EQUAL
address
3HqjuijhWvRpmwMhPfTD6HwMubGtUGsF1K
transaction
12bbcfc27ecee34ea69a299ef0d6243b14afcdbadf745590911460240e589b64
spent
true